The Fine Print That Will Bite You (T&Cs Breakdown)
Let me be blunt. The wagering requirements on these offers are often brutal. You might see a 50x or even 60x playthrough. That is not a typo. For a £5 free bonus, you might need to wager £250 before you can withdraw a penny. That is why I always check the max cashout first.

How to Claim These Offers Without Getting Burned
I have made mistakes. I once claimed a free spin offer without reading the game restrictions. The spins were only valid on a slot with a 96% RTP. That is fine. But the wagering had to be done on other slots that had a 94% RTP. That is a hidden trap. Always check which games contribute 100% to the wagering.
Here is my personal checklist before I click ‘Claim’:
- Check the expiry date. Most codes are valid for 7 days or less.
- Look for a max bet limit. Some offers say you cannot bet more than £5 per spin while wagering.
- See if the bonus is ‘sticky’ or ‘non-withdrawable’. Sticky means you only get the winnings, not the bonus amount.
- Confirm the payment method. Some offers exclude Skrill or Neteller deposits.

The Reality of Wagering Requirements in 2026
I have seen wagering requirements get worse over the last year. Some sites now require 60x on free spins. That is almost impossible to beat. You would need to hit a massive win just to break even. I avoid those offers entirely. My rule is simple: if the wagering is above 40x, I skip it. It is not worth the time.
There is one exception. If the game you are playing has a high RTP, like 98% on certain video slots, then a 40x wagering is borderline acceptable. But you are still gambling. The house always has the edge.
